Easy hiking trails around the Kaunertal are set within the Tyrolean Alps, offering an accessible alpine environment. The region features a network of paths through glacial landscapes, alpine meadows, and dense forests. Hikers can explore wild gorges, waterfalls, and serene mountain lakes. The terrain includes gentle valley walks and paths leading to historic farmhouses, providing varied options for easy exploration.

A rewarding stop at the Verpeil waterfall in Feichten. This is the entrance to the Verpeil gorge, which can only be walked in one direction, which would take at least 1.5 hours (a paid circular route with various attractions). There are benches at the waterfall and it is truly worth seeing!

Kaunertal offers a diverse network of trails, with approximately 47 easy hiking routes available for exploration. These trails are set within the Tyrolean Alps, featuring varied landscapes from glacial environments to alpine meadows.
The easy hiking trails in Kaunertal are highly regarded by the komoot community, holding an average rating of 4.7 stars from over 2,300 reviews. Hikers often praise the region's stunning natural features, such as waterfalls and serene mountain lakes, and the well-maintained paths.
Yes, Kaunertal is well-suited for families, offering many easy hiking trails. Some routes are even suitable for buggies, providing accessible options for all ages to enjoy the alpine environment. The Animal Tracks Quiz Station – Hotel Weisseespitze loop from Fagge is an example of a route with engaging elements for children.
Yes, Kaunertal features several easy circular hiking routes. These loops allow you to experience different aspects of the landscape without retracing your steps. An example is the Verpeil Waterfall – Steep Ascent Trail loop from Kaunertal, which offers views of the waterfall and surrounding alpine scenery.
Absolutely. Kaunertal is known for its impressive waterfalls and wild gorges. The Verpeil Gorge trail leads directly through a notable gorge with views of the Verpeil Waterfall. Another option is the View of the Fagge River – Braunelle Information Board loop from Kaunertal, which offers scenic river views.
Easy hikes in Kaunertal showcase a variety of natural features. You can explore glacial landscapes, serene mountain lakes like the Hidden Lake, and the impressive Gepatsch Reservoir. The region also boasts green alpine meadows, dense forests, and the dramatic Kaunergrat Nature Park.
Yes, some easy trails in Kaunertal pass by historic sites. For instance, the Walser Information Point – View of Grasse and the Ögghöfe loop from Kaunertal offers views of the Ögghöfe farmhouses, which are among the oldest surviving farmhouses in the valley. You can also find trails leading to cultural monuments like Burg Berneck.
Many easy hiking trails in Kaunertal lead to or pass by traditional mountain huts (Alms) where you can find refreshments and rest. The Nassereialpe – Nasserei Alm loop from Kaunertal, for example, takes you through alpine pastures where such huts are often located. The Gepatschhaus is another notable spot.
The summer months are ideal for easy hiking in Kaunertal, offering pleasant temperatures and lush green landscapes. However, the region also provides opportunities for winter hiking and snowshoeing, transforming into a snowy wonderland. Always check local conditions before heading out.
Yes, Kaunertal offers numerous easy hikes with rewarding viewpoints. Many routes provide spectacular panoramas of the surrounding Ötztal and Kaunertal Alps. The Hotel Weisseespitze – View Toward Kauns loop from Platz is an example of a trail that offers scenic vistas.
Easy hiking trails in Kaunertal feature varied terrain, from gentle valley walks to paths through alpine meadows and dense forests. While generally well-maintained, some routes may include slight ascents or descents, such as the Gepatschhaus – View of Gepatschspeicher loop from Gepatschhaus, which has minimal elevation changes.
